Abilitare mcrypt e pdo_mysql

Vediamo oggi come abilitare le esensioni php mcryp.dll e psd_mysql , parti richieste da alcuni cms come magento :
La prima cosa da fare e verificare se le estensioni sono attive e le versioni in uso . Creiamo quindi un file php che ci permetterà di eseguire la richiesta dell’informazione .

<?php echo phpinfo(); ?>

Salviamo il file con il nome phpinfo.php , ed avviamolo ; avremo quindi una schermata simile :


In questo caso abbiamo attive le estensioni . Nel caso non sono presenti vuol dire che sono non attive o incompatibili . Per attivarle andremo a modificare il file php.ini di configurazione presente in nella cartella php se usiamo un server locale .
Cerchiamo le righe qui sotto elencate dove andremo a eliminare il “;”
Di conseguenza avremo queste estensioni da abilitare :

  • ;extension=php_mcrypt.dl
  • ;extension=php_pdo_mysql.dll
  • ;extension=php_curl.dll

Inoltre aggiungiamo :

  • extension=php_pdo.dll

Al fine di evitare l’errore in magento : PHP extension “mcrypt” must be loaded.

    Una volta effettuata la modifica riproviamo il test php per vedere se l’operazione è andata a buon fine.